Israel's cloud computing landscape in 2026 shows remarkable growth with an $8.5 billion investment, driven by increased digitalization and startup activity. The widespread adoption by 78% of businesses highlights the nation's commitment to leveraging cloud technology for efficiency and innovation. Cost-saving measures have become a priority, with companies saving an average of 23%, emphasizing the importance of cloud cost optimization strategies.

The competitive environment features around 35 cloud service providers, offering diverse solutions tailored to local needs. While the benefits are clear, security remains a critical concern, with 120 reported incidents, prompting ongoing investments in cloud security infrastructure. Overall, Israel's cloud ecosystem is rapidly evolving, positioning it as a regional leader in cloud adoption and digital transformation.
